Gaining a payment on item recommendations doesn't always indicate your fee-based consultant antagonizes your benefits. However they might be extra inclined to advise product or services on which they make a compensation, which may or might not be in your ideal interest. A fiduciary is legally bound to place their client's rate of interests.
They may comply with a loosely checked "suitability" requirement if they're not registered fiduciaries. This common allows them to make suggestions for investments and services as long as they match their customer's goals, risk tolerance, and monetary circumstance. This can convert to recommendations that will certainly additionally gain them cash. On the other hand, fiduciary experts are lawfully obliged to act in their customer's benefit as opposed to their very own.
